Output 51a01026fe85a475a28eec256ff4e90a3f2e15fa964463acf45c9844734a32fd:28

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 705326e037d7d457494b2e08517cfb24c8c3ecf6a239e4279122c43ae0d94bf4
address
tb1pwpfjdcph6l29wj2t9cy9zl8mynyv8m8k5gu7gfu3ytzr4cxef06q4jq243
transaction
51a01026fe85a475a28eec256ff4e90a3f2e15fa964463acf45c9844734a32fd
confirmations
61814
spent
true